Output 77824e0d6ee978c106a74ea35814390251f0f199634eae4e070793afae726816:713

value
39000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7fc996136ad4ee60612d322c149420ac78392a0 OP_EQUAL
address
ADauMbfXKz2DZxAEKGTYjFjyKhB5V3pAWe
transaction
77824e0d6ee978c106a74ea35814390251f0f199634eae4e070793afae726816